Why the “Free” Money Never Sticks
UK punters eyeing a USA casino for UK players no deposit bonus quickly learn that “free” is a filthy word in the gambling underworld. A bonus that asks for zero cash up front sounds like a charity, yet the fine print turns it into a tax. The moment you click “claim”, you’re shackled to wagering requirements that make a marathon look like a sprint. Bet365, William Hill, and LeoVegas each parade a no‑deposit offer, but the conditions are practically identical – a roulette of hoops you must jump through before a single penny lands in your wallet.
Because the operators know we’ll chase the promise, they hide the most punitive clauses under headings like “Terms & Conditions”. A typical stipulation demands a 30x playthrough on a “low‑risk” game, then caps the cash‑out at £10. That’s about as generous as a free spin at the dentist – you get a tiny distraction, but the real pain comes later.

What the Savvy Player Actually Does
Veterans treat the no‑deposit bonus like a diagnostic test – you run it, note the outcomes, and move on. First, you register, claim the bonus, and read every clause. Then you pick a game with the highest RTP that still counts toward the wagering. You avoid the flashy slots that promise high volatility because they chew up your bankroll faster than a hamster on a wheel. Instead, you gravitate toward classics like Blackjack or European Roulette, where the house edge is transparent and the playthrough is more manageable.
But even the most disciplined approach can’t outrun the maths. The operator’s algorithm recalculates the required stake the moment you place a bet, ensuring you’ll never quite reach the break‑even point without spending actual cash. It’s a clever trap, a bit like being handed a “gift” card that only works on items you’ll never buy.
